Boo at the Zoo is 42, and tickets are on sale now
 The Louisville Zoo’s ever-popular annual Boo at the Zoo presented by Meijer is celebrating 42 years of merry not scary fun! This beloved event will begin early, starting September 30 and running through October 29, Thursday through Sunday nights.
Tickets are all-inclusive and include Boo at the Zoo admission, parking, Spooktacular Carousel, “not-so-itsy-bitsy” Spider House and the Headless Horseman of Sleepy Hollow attraction.
Guests can dress up in their wildest costumes for the after-hours event that turns the Zoo into a living storybook, complete with favorite characters brought to life. There will be music, photo opportunities around every corner and, of course, a safe place to trick-or-treat for kids 11 and under. Guests are encouraged to bring their own trick-or-treat bags, but reusable treat bags will be available for purchase at the Zoo’s Gift Shop for $2 (while supplies last).
Tickets are $13.50 for non-members (both adults and children 3 and older) and $7 for members (both adults and children 3 and older). Children 2 and under are free and do not require a ticket.
Members and guests can purchase tickets online at louisvillezoo.org/boo, with their chosen date and arrival time. Ticket capacity is limited each night with popular nights expected to sell out quickly. Boo at the Zoo is a rain or shine event and provides critical support every year to the Zoo’s animal care programs, visitor experience and conservation education.
Boo at the Zoo is presented by Meijer and sponsored by Great Clips, Norton Children’s, PNC Grow Up, UPS, Councilman Pat Mulvihill & District 10 residents, Ky Saves 529 and USA Image.
Thursday, October 19 is Allergy-Friendly Night and will feature peanut-free treat booths and added non-food treats like stickers, pencils and more. Children with allergies can receive a teal token redeemable for an allergy-friendly option at our Switch Witch booth.
